November 30, 201411 yr Author Tear down went well, got everything apart with only having to grind 2 bolt heads off. Everything else came apart with some knocker-lose and elbow grease. Original fire pan/box seemed very thin how thick should I build the new one, Will 1/4" be enough?
December 1, 201411 yr Greetings Teach, 1/4 plate is more than enough for the base... 14 gage for the outer ring will work just fine... I would suggest a cut away in the outer ring for long stock.. Easy project and fun too.. It will be up and ready to forge in no time... I wish you well Forge on and make beautiful things Jim
